Your hotel’s in-room entertainment system influences guest satisfaction, operational ease, and revenue opportunities. Both DIRECTV by Groove Technology Solutions and Monscierge (Apple TV for Hospitality) aim to elevate this experience, but they serve different needs and expectations. DIRECTV offers a traditional, cable-based service with options for streaming, whereas Monscierge focuses on streaming content, guest interaction, and local engagement. Which solution aligns better with your hotel’s strategic goals?
The choice hinges on whether your priority is high-quality live TV with extensive content options or a flexible, guest-centric streaming and engagement platform. Are you seeking a familiar TV experience or cutting-edge guest interaction features?
DIRECTV by Groove Technology Solutions provides a comprehensive in-room entertainment solution centered on delivering HD live TV channels, including news, sports, and international programming. Its architecture is built for scalability and customization, supporting various deployment options like residential and commercial headends, making it ideal for large properties wanting extensive TV content.
Monscierge, on the other hand, emphasizes streaming, guest engagement, and local content delivery. Its platform supports popular apps like Netflix, Hulu, and YouTube, with additional features like messaging, local recommendations, and analytics, making it more suitable for hotels prioritizing guest personalization and digital interaction.
While DIRECTV’s system is more traditional, focused on delivering a broad range of live channels, Monscierge’s approach is more modern, integrating streaming and guest communication. Do you want your system to be more about traditional TV or a platform for guest interaction and digital content?
If your hotel primarily targets luxury, boutique, or vacation properties, Monscierge’s streaming and guest engagement features will likely boost satisfaction. Its ability to provide personalized content, local recommendations, and messaging appeals to guests accustomed to home entertainment and digital services.
Conversely, if your property caters to travelers expecting extensive live TV options and international content—like conference hotels or resorts—DIRECTV’s wide HD channel selection might be more appropriate. The platform’s scalability and centralized management also benefit large, multi-property operators.
For hoteliers seeking innovative guest experiences, Monscierge offers a more flexible, content-rich environment. If your focus is on providing traditional TV entertainment with minimal fuss, DIRECTV remains a reliable, established choice.

The HT Score is a composite ranking that considers 4 criteria groups and over a dozen variables to help hoteliers objectively compare hotel technology products. Groove Technology Solutions has an HT Score of 0 and Monscierge has 44. Here is how the score is calculated.
| Criteria Group | Weight | What It Measures |
|---|---|---|
| Customer Ratings & Reviews |
|
How highly do users recommend this product? Ratings Score, Review Volume, Share of Voice, Review Depth, Review Recency, Success Stories ▾ The most heavily weighted factor. Analyzes average satisfaction ratings (likelihood to recommend, ease of use, support, ROI), total review count relative to category peers, review recency (at least 20 reviews in the trailing 6 months), and share of voice across unique hotel clients to detect selection bias. |
| Partner Ecosystem |
|
How highly do tech partners recommend this company? Partner Recommendations, Integration Quantity, Integration Quality ▾ Evaluates partner recommendations as expert votes of confidence, the number of verified integrations, and ecosystem quality — the average HT Scores of integration partners. Products with higher-quality integration ecosystems are more likely to deliver a connected tech stack. |
| Customer Centricity |
|
How customer-centric is this organization? Certified Support, Review Consistency, Profile Completeness ▾ Assesses whether the company has earned HTR Customer Support Certification, maintains consistent review collection over time (an indicator of feedback-driven culture), and keeps product profiles complete with capabilities, screenshots, pricing, and features. |
| Reach, Staying Power & Resources |
|
How extensive is this company's reach and resourcing? Geographic Reach, Staying Power, Company Resources, Trending Score ▾ Measures global presence (countries and regions served), years in business as a stability proxy, team headcount as a resource proxy, and a trending score based on trailing-twelve-month buyer inquiries, reviews, partner recommendations, and press activity. |
Customer ratings and reviews are by far the most important factor in the HT Score algorithm. HTR does not accept payment for higher rankings. All reviews are verified — only hotel industry practitioners with confirmed affiliations can submit ratings. View full HT Score methodology →
